How To Buy Cryptocurrency Without KYC

How To Buy Cryptocurrency Without KYC

In the world of cryptocurrency, one of the biggest concerns for investors is the requirement of KYC (Know Your Customer) and AML (Anti-Money Laundering) verification. KYC regulations are meant to prevent money laundering, terrorist financing, and other illegal activities in the cryptocurrency space. However, for some investors, these regulations can be a major deterrent to investing in cryptocurrencies. This article aims to provide some tips on how to buy cryptocurrency without KYC verification.

First and foremost, it’s important to understand that not all cryptocurrency exchanges require KYC verification. There are several exchanges that allow users to buy and sell cryptocurrencies without KYC verification, but it’s important to note that the trading volumes on these exchanges are usually lower, and the liquidity of the exchanges is often limited.

One of the best options for buying cryptocurrency without KYC verification is using peer-to-peer (P2P) exchanges. P2P exchanges connect buyers and sellers directly and facilitate the exchange of cryptocurrencies without the need for an intermediary. Some popular P2P exchanges include Local Coin Swap, Agoradesk, and Bisq. These exchanges allow users to buy and sell cryptocurrencies using a variety of payment methods, including bank transfers, PayPal, cash deposits, and even gift cards.

Another option for buying cryptocurrency without KYC verification is using decentralized exchanges (DEXs). DEXs are built on blockchain technology and operate without a central authority or intermediary. As a result, they do not require KYC verification. Some popular DEXs include Uniswap, PancakeSwap, and SushiSwap. However, it’s important to note that DEXs can be more difficult to use for beginners and may have higher fees than centralized exchanges.

A third option for buying cryptocurrency without KYC verification is using Bitcoin ATMs. Bitcoin ATMs are machines that allow users to buy and sell cryptocurrencies using cash or debit cards. They can be found in various locations, such as shopping malls, airports, and convenience stores. However, it’s important to note that Bitcoin ATMs may have higher fees than other methods of buying cryptocurrency.

In addition to these options, it’s important to take some precautions when buying cryptocurrency without KYC verification. It’s important to choose a reputable exchange or platform and to research the seller before buying any cryptocurrency. It’s also important to keep your cryptocurrency safe by using a secure wallet and not sharing your private keys with anyone.
